Walmart's Record-Breaking Revenue

According to Walmart's financial report, the company generated over $559 billion in revenue for the past fiscal year, a significant increase from the previous year's earnings. This staggering number can be attributed to Walmart's ability to adapt to changes within the retail industry, with their continued investment in online shopping and increased focus on customer experience.

E-commerce Sales Surge

One of the key factors that contributed to Walmart's success is the surge in e-commerce sales. Due to the shift in consumer behavior amid the pandemic, Walmart's e-commerce sales surged by 79%. Shift in Consumer Behavior

During the pandemic, there was a significant shift in consumer behavior, with more people relying on e-commerce and home delivery services. Walmart was able to adapt quickly, doubling their online grocery capacity and launching new pickup and delivery options to meet the demand.

Ensuring Safety Measures

With the increased demand for essential goods, Walmart was able to implement safety measures to protect their employees and customers. They implemented policies such as mandatory face coverings, plexiglass barriers, and social distancing to ensure the safety of everyone who entered their stores.

Table: Walmart's Annual Revenue (in billions)

Year Revenue
2016 $485.87
2017 $500.34
2018 $514.41
2019 $523.96
2020 $559.15

The Remarkable Growth Story

Walmart's annual revenue has witnessed a steady increase over the past few years, establishing it as one of the world's most successful companies. Let's delve into the factors that have propelled Walmart's revenue growth.

  1. Expansive Store Network: Walmart operates thousands of stores worldwide, enabling it to reach customers across various regions. This extensive presence contributes significantly to its revenue generation.
  2. Everyday Low Prices: Walmart's strategic approach of offering affordable prices attracts a large customer base. By providing everyday low prices, it has gained a reputation as a cost-effective shopping destination, leading to increased sales and revenue.
  3. E-commerce Transformation: Recognizing the growing importance of online retail, Walmart invested heavily in its e-commerce capabilities. The company's online sales have witnessed remarkable growth, contributing significantly to its annual revenue.
  4. Supply Chain Efficiency: Walmart has developed a highly efficient supply chain, allowing it to streamline operations, reduce costs, and offer competitive prices. This efficiency has played a crucial role in supporting revenue growth.
